Signs Indicating the Need for Roof Painting

  • A roof's color fading or becoming discolored is a clear indicator that it's time for a fresh coat of paint. Sun exposure, weather conditions, and age contribute to this gradual change. As the original color diminishes, the roof's protective qualities often degrade as well. This affects the home's aesthetic appeal and signals that the roof may be more vulnerable to UV rays and moisture damage. Addressing this issue can prevent further deterioration and extend the roof's lifespan.

  • When roof paint begins to peel or crack, it's a sign that the protective barrier is failing. This damage exposes the underlying roofing material to the elements, potentially leading to more serious issues like leaks or structural damage. Peeling and cracking often start in small areas but can quickly spread across the roof's surface. Timely repainting prevents water infiltration and protects the roof from accelerated wear and tear, maintaining its integrity and appearance for years to come.

  • The appearance of rust or corrosion on a metal roof indicates a breakdown of its protective coating. This oxidation process can compromise the roof's structural integrity if left unchecked. Rust spots may start small but can spread rapidly, especially when the humity is high or the area sees frequent rainfall. Painting over rust, after proper preparation, improves the roof's appearance and provides a new layer of protection against further corrosion, extending the life of the metal roofing material.

  • An unexpected rise in energy costs may be linked to the condition of the roof's paint. As paint deteriorates, it loses its reflective properties, allowing more heat to penetrate the home. This increased heat absorption forces cooling systems to work harder, resulting in higher energy consumption. Repainting the roof with a high-quality, reflective paint can significantly improve the home's energy efficiency. This simple upgrade can lead to noticeable reductions in cooling costs, especially during hot summer months.

  • Water stains on ceilings or walls often indicate that the roof's protective paint layer has failed. As paint deteriorates, it can allow water to seep through, causing damage to the roof structure and interior of the home. Even small leaks may lead to significant problems over time, including mold growth and weakened structural integrity. Prompt roof painting, combined with necessary repairs, creates a watertight seal that prevents moisture intrusion and protects the home from costly water damage.

Our Roof Painting Process

  • Inspection and Assessment

    Roof painting begins with inspecting the roof to determine its condition. Experienced professionals examine every aspect of the roof, including its structure, material, and current paint condition. This critical step identifies any underlying issues that need addressing before painting can commence. The assessment also determines the most suitable paint type and application method for the specific roof. This evaluation serves as the foundation for a successful, long-lasting roof painting project.

  • Surface Preparation

    Sufficient surface preparation is crucial for achieving a durable and attractive finish. This stage involves cleaning the roof thoroughly to remove dirt, debris, and any loose paint. Power washing is often employed to achieve a clean surface. Rust treatment may be necessary for metal roofs. Any damaged areas are repaired, and the entire surface is primed to create an ideal base for the new paint. This meticulous preparation process improves paint adhesion and enhances the longevity of the new coating.

  • Painting Application

    The actual painting process utilizes advanced techniques and top-quality materials tailored to the specific roof type. Professional painters apply the paint evenly, using methods such as spraying or rolling to achieve optimal coverage. Multiple coats may be necessary to provide adequate protection and achieve the desired color depth. Special attention is given to problematic areas like seams, edges, and around vents. This careful application process results in a uniform, attractive finish that effectively shields the roof from environmental elements.

  • Drying and Curing

    After the paint application, sufficient time is allocated for drying and curing. This crucial phase allows the paint to adhere properly and develop its protective properties. The duration depends on factors such as paint type, weather conditions, and roof material. During this time, the roof is monitored to prevent any disturbances that could affect the finish. Proper drying and curing are essential for achieving a durable, long-lasting paint job that can withstand various weather conditions and provide optimal protection for years to come.

  • Final Inspection

    Once the paint has fully cured, technicians inspect the finished product to verify the quality of the work. This thorough examination checks for uniform coverage, proper adhesion, and overall appearance. Any touch-ups or adjustments are made as necessary to perfect the finish. The inspection also confirms that all areas of the roof have been adequately protected and that the project meets high-quality standards. This final step guarantees customer satisfaction and establishes confidence in the durability and effectiveness of the newly painted roof.

Types of Roofs We Paint

  • Asphalt shingle roofs, popular for their affordability and versatility, benefit greatly from professional painting. The painting process revitalizes worn shingles, restoring their protective qualities and enhancing curb appeal. Special acrylic-based paints are used to adhere effectively to the granular surface of asphalt shingles. This type of paint improves the roof's appearance and creates additional protection against UV rays and moisture. Painting asphalt shingles can significantly extend the roof's lifespan, delaying the need for costly replacements.

  • Painting metal roofs requires specialized techniques and materials to combat unique challenges such as expansion, contraction, and potential rust. High-quality, rust-inhibiting paints are applied to provide long-lasting protection against corrosion and weathering. The painting process can dramatically improve a metal roof's heat-reflective properties, potentially reducing energy costs. With proper preparation and application, painted metal roofs can maintain their attractive appearance and structural integrity for many years, making them a cost-effective and durable roofing solution.

  • Tile roofs, known for their durability and aesthetic appeal, can be transformed through professional painting. The process involves careful cleaning and preparation to remove dirt and algae growth common on tile surfaces. Specialized paints are used that bond well with clay or concrete tiles while allowing them to breathe. Painting refreshes the roof's appearance and seals small cracks and pores, enhancing the tiles' water-resistant properties. This treatment can revitalize an aging tile roof, preserving its beauty and extending its functional life.

  • Painting flat roofs presents unique challenges due to their propensity for water pooling. Special elastomeric coatings are often used, which create a seamless, waterproof membrane over the entire surface. These coatings expand and contract with temperature changes, preventing cracks and leaks. The painting process for flat roofs often includes reinforcing vulnerable areas such as seams and flashings. A well-executed paint job on a flat roof can significantly improve its water resistance, thermal efficiency, and overall longevity, making it a valuable investment for building owners.
